President Trump is facing mounting judicial scrutiny as a federal judge signaled potential challenges for his $10 billion lawsuit against the Internal Revenue Service, raising questions about the strength of the legal arguments presented. The case, which has drawn national attention, centers on allegations that the agency acted improperly in matters related to tax oversight and disclosure.
The judge’s remarks during preliminary proceedings suggested skepticism about key aspects of the claim, indicating that the case may encounter significant hurdles as it moves forward. Legal analysts have pointed out that early judicial signals often provide insight into how a case could unfold.
President Trump’s legal team has maintained confidence in their position, arguing that the lawsuit raises important constitutional and procedural issues.
